Löfbergs acquires 100 per cent stake in Danish roaster

Claus Bertelsen, CEO, Peter Larsen Kaffe. Image: Peter Larsen Kaffe.
Swedish coffee roaster Löfbergs has fully acquired Danish roaster Peter Larsen Kaffe. Oatly reports 5 per cent increase in 2024 revenue

Image: MaddieRedPhotography/stock.adobe.comAlternative milk company Oatly has reported a 5 per cent increase in its top-line in 2024 as part of its fourth quarter results.
